The 90’s band Spice Girls are giving their fans what they want, what they really, really want, by getting back together again to close out the 2012 London Olympics. This is fantastic news for fans of the popular girl band who have not performed live together since 2007.

The Daily Mail reports that the gorgeous quintet were spotted recently rehearsing for their show at the Ford car plant in Dagenham, east London.
This Sunday, Victoria Beckham, Emma Burton, Geri Halliwell, Mel B and Mel C will once again transform into their alter egos Posh Spice, Baby Spice, Ginger Spice, Sporty Spice and Scary Spice in front of millions of viewers worldwide.
Mel C had hinted at the reunion in an interview earlier in the year. The singer said, “We were proud to be British and to be successful internationally, and we were the last band probably to do that. So I think it would be a real shame if we were not acknowledged in some way at the Olympics.”
